WebA fronted adverbial includes words or phrases which add some extra information to a sentence. The adverbial words or phrases are placed at the start of the sentence and come before the verb. For example, ‘later in the evening, I found my missing cat’. Download FREE teacher-made resources covering 'fronted adverbial'.
